Duomo
Marvel at one of the most impressive Cathedral of Milan. You can visit its interior and its roof with its suggestive spires.

Castello Sforzesco
The former residence of Sforza’s dynasty, it is now one of the pillars of Milan.

Navigli
Take a walk on Navigli: in the past it was a system of interconnected waterways but today it is the beating heart of Milan's nightlife.

Pinacoteca di Brera
It is one of the best museum in Milan with a lot of masterpieces such as the Hayez Kiss. Situated in one of the most suggestive areas of the city, Brera district is now populated by many shops and cafès.

Cenacolo
Enjoy a marvelous view of the Cenacolo by Leonardo da Vinci in the refectory of Santa Maria delle Grazie. You need to book the visit online because of the high number of visitors.

Arco Della Pace
Dating back to the 19th century, Sempione gate is a triumphal arch located in the center of Piazza Sempione. The whole area is one of the centres of the so-called "Movida Milanese"

Triennale
From 1923 La Triennale di Milano is a design and art museum in Parco Sempione.
